Xentropics® is a small consulting and engineering firm for organisations that work with complex information, collections, datasets and systems.

What we do

We work mainly in museums, libraries, archives, heritage and the performing arts, with a strong overlap into higher education and public administration.

Depending on the assignment, that can mean a digital strategy, an information architecture, a system selection, a linked data model, an Omeka S platform, a data pipeline, a cloud migration plan or a working proof of concept.

The common thread is pragmatic translation: from policy to architecture, from architecture to implementation, and from implementation to maintainable services.

Markets

Xentropics® works mainly for heritage and performing arts organisations, universities and research organisations, and national knowledge infrastructure around libraries, archives and digital heritage.

Reference customers include RCE, KB, OCLC, University of Amsterdam, KNAW Humanities Cluster, Tresoar, Erfgoedhuis Zuid-Holland, Louis Andriessen Platform, Mongui Maduro Library and Hoes veur 't Limburgs.
